Output 1b0b158130b342c488afd5469130fc71a5866c4f39eb535f51c9260db7e6216b:0

value
3027647150
script pubkey
OP_0 OP_PUSHBYTES_20 6f7d97786489eb932923195aa8ba04fe3be01d77
address
tb1qda7ew7ry384ex2frr9d23wsylca7q8thsc5xgk
transaction
1b0b158130b342c488afd5469130fc71a5866c4f39eb535f51c9260db7e6216b
confirmations
108066
spent
true